Domestic travel is the act of traveling for leisure or business within one's own country of residence. Unlike international travel, it does not involve crossing borders, dealing with passports, or navigating visa requirements. This form of tourism encompasses everything from a weekend city break to a cross-country road trip, encouraging the exploration of local landscapes, cultures, and attractions that are often overlooked.
The surge in domestic travel is driven by several key factors. Post-pandemic shifts have made travelers favor closer, more predictable destinations. Economically, it's often more affordable, sidestepping costly international flights and unfavorable currency exchanges. Furthermore, a growing environmental consciousness has led many to reduce their carbon footprint by avoiding long-haul flights. This 'staycation' trend reflects a renewed desire to discover hidden gems and support local economies.
Domestic travel positively impacts both travelers and communities. For individuals, it simplifies logistics, reduces travel-related stress, and makes vacations more accessible. It fosters a deeper connection to their own nation's heritage and natural beauty. For local communities, it provides a vital economic boost, supporting small businesses, hotels, and restaurants, thereby strengthening the national tourism industry from within.
